About this role

Here at The Exploration Company, we are developing, producing, and operating Nyx, a modular and reusable space orbital vehicle that can eventually be refuelled in orbit and that can carry cargo - and potentially humans in the longer run.

We want you as a talented and experienced Ground Segment Engineer to help us in our mission by working on the ground segment for our Future Projects. You will be part of the Lunar Lander team, reporting to the Principal Engineer of the project and working closely with the other engineering disciplines.

Key Responsibilities

In your capacity as a Ground Segment Engineer, your role will continuously evolve, but initially your day-to-day duties will include:

  • Own the ground segment for the project

    • Define the architecture of the ground segment

    • Design and develop ground segment HW and SW tools

    • Ensure reliability through rigorous automated and manual testing

    • Document the ground segment tools

    • Procure all related HW and means for the ground segment

    • Validate the ground segment performances

  • Partner with testing and operations teams to understand and meet needs

  • Support test procedures definition

  • Support test operations

What we would love to see from you

In the role of Ground Segment Engineer ideally, you will have the following:

  • 3+ years of experience in ground segment development for aerospace projects

  • Experience with development and testing of user-facing software applications

  • Proficiency in at least one object-oriented programming language like C#, Java, or similar

  • Familiarity with aerospace telecommunication standards

  • Knowledge of backup systems, storage management, and recovery procedures

  • Experience with hardware integration and RF systems

  • Strong troubleshooting skills across hardware, OS, networking, and application layers

  • Fluent in English, knowledge of Arabic is an asset
